In 2014, he wrote a warning letter to faculty about publishing in predatory journals. The companys former publisher, John Birky, told her that OMICS had also bought the Pulsus Group, a legitimate publisher that managed the Canadian Journal of Respiratory Therapy and more than 30 other credible publications. People are starting predatory journal operations for those overseas scholars, and running the journals out of their houses in suburbs of Toronto and places like that. For instance, a group from Pakistan runs scientific publisher ScienceVier a riff on the name of the well-known, reputable publisher Elsevier out of a Hamilton, Ontario, apartment building.
